ABSTRACT A pyrolysis method was employed to deposit Co doped RuO 2 nanoparticles on nitrogen‐doped hollow carbon spheres (NHCS). Attributed to the excellent bifunctional electrocatalytic properties of Co‐RuO 2 @NHCS, the zinc‐air battery yielded an open circuit voltage of 1.51 V and the power density reached 180 mW/m 2 . After 800 galvanostatic charge‐discharge cycles, the charge‐discharge voltage gap of the battery only decayed by 5.7%, demonstrating superior cycling stability.
